   The Divorce Course: A Free Educational Seminar

   Covering topics from the legal, financial and emotional aspects and more of divorce

           Divorce is not for the uneducated. Knowing what you are entitled to and how to make    sure your rights and property are protected are paramount. Who to trust, what to do and  how to get started are just a handful of the questions for those going through the process or considering a divorce. If you or someone you know are getting a divorce or thinking about divorce, then don’t miss a free educational seminar – The Complete Divorce Course on Thursday, December 8,  7p.m. to 9 p.m. at The Cherry Hill Library in their Half Conference Center, Lower Level.

 Lynda Hinkle is spearheading the educational seminar as part of her commitment to the community.  This program is designed to help anyone seeking advice about divorce and might be intimidated to take the first step and seek legal advice and meet with an attorney.

“My hope is that the seminar offers more than just an education about the legalities about divorce but offers  a better understanding that there are many professionals available to assist families deal with all the pertinent  issues surrounding divorce; from how to deal with the finances or the emotional dealings of divorce. Divorce does not have to mean disaster.  This seminar is one-stop-shopping on divorce,” said Hinkle.  “It’s my hope that anyone that is in a bad situation will take advantage of this unique opportunity to come, learn and ask questions in a friendly atmosphere. It’s critical to be well informed about divorce,” said Hinkle.

The line-up of speakers includes the following:

  • Lynda L. Hinkle, L.L.C.  – The legal divorce process from beginning to end!
  • Roseann Vanella – Professional Mediator – Mediation – Contemporary and Cost Effective Approach to Divorce.
  • Kay Larrabee – The Divorce Concierge of South Jersey – Steps you can take before a divorce action occurs that can protect yourself, your children and your assets.
  • Dr. Michael Plumeri – Clinical Psychologist – Divorce an Emotional Experience
  • Lynn DeVasto, CRPC, CDFA – Wealth Advisor- “Getting with the Right Financial Decisions”
